Pizza, the beloved dish enjoyed worldwide, is a blank canvas for culinary creativity. From classic combinations to daring gourmet adventures, the world of pizza toppings offers endless possibilities. Whether you prefer the simplicity of pepperoni and cheese or crave something more adventurous, there's a perfect topping combination waiting to be discovered.
Let's embark on a journey through the diverse realm of pizza toppings, exploring both traditional favorites and innovative choices that will tantalize your taste buds.
- Classic Toppings: Start with the foundations of pizza perfection. Pepperoni, sausage, mushrooms, onions, green peppers, and olives are staples that never disappoint. These familiar flavors create a harmonious balance that satisfies every palate.
- Sophisticated Toppings: For those seeking a more refined experience, gourmet toppings elevate pizza to new heights. Consider adding artisanal cheeses like goat cheese or gorgonzola, succulent roasted vegetables, fragrant herbs like rosemary or thyme, or even flavorful cured meats like prosciutto or pancetta.
- Out-of-the-Box Toppings: Unleash your inner pizza chef and experiment with unconventional toppings. Pineapple, bacon, jalapenos, and kimchi add a touch of sweetness, smokiness, heat, and umami to create unique flavor profiles. The possibilities are truly limitless!
Decoding the Art of an Ideal Pizza Crust
Crafting the perfect pizza crust is a culinary alchemy that involves mastering the magic behind flour, water, yeast, and heat. The key ingredient in this equation is gluten, a protein found in wheat flour that develops long strands when mixed with water, giving to the crust's structure. As the dough rises, yeast consumes sugar and releases carbon dioxide, creating tiny bubbles that inflate the dough.
The cooking process alters these bubbles into a crispy outer layer while here the interior remains tender. Capturing this harmony of textures and flavors is what sets a truly exceptional pizza crust apart.
- Variables that impact the final product include the type of flour used, the climate during fermentation, and the length spent baking.
Exploring with different techniques and ingredients allows chefs to craft their own signature crusts, each a testament to the complexities of this beloved food.
